Load‑bearing behaviors of sandwich plates with non‑uniformly distributed grid cores : Static compression and bending
Published 2023“…Under bending loading, most NUGPs experience local failure at the loading head, while the specific category surpassing GPs undergoes shear buckling in longer grid walls. (3) Deformation modes of the core layer, mechanical analysis, thin plate buckling theory, and equivalent bending stiffness calculations elucidate the load-bearing mechanisms of NUGPs. These findings enhance topology optimization research for sandwich plates, provide guidance for grid wall arrangements under different loading conditions, and offer insights for designing lightweight sandwich structures.…”

Effect of geometric scaling on the microstructural development of selective laser melted metal parts
Published 2022“…Process parameters play a huge role in affecting materials' microstructure and mechanical properties in selective laser melting (SLM). This study discusses the effect of geometric scaling, delay time (i.e., the time it takes for the laser beam to jump from one scan vector to the adjacent scan vector, which is controlled by the jump speed), gas flow, and defocusing distance on microstructural development and mechanical properties of selective laser melted 316L stainless steel. 316L stainless steel has been used in various industries such as aerospace and petrochemical industries due to its superior properties such as very good corrosion resistance. …”
